Basically, a surety bond includes three parties: you (the obligee), the professional (the principal), and the surety (the firm backing the bond). If the professional fails to deliver on their commitments, the surety action in to cover any kind of monetary losses you sustain.
It's essential to know that surety bonds aren't insurance policy for contractors; rather, they ensure liability. By familiarizing on your own with the kinds of bonds-- performance, payment, and bid bonds-- you can much better browse the building landscape and guard your financial investment.

Contract surety bonds use substantial benefits for both job proprietors and contractors in the construction industry.
For task proprietors, these bonds make certain that service providers accomplish their responsibilities, providing satisfaction and financial protection. If a professional defaults, the surety firm action in to finish the job or compensates the owner, minimizing prospective losses.
